P0546 — Exhaust Gas Temperature Sensor Circuit High Bank 1 Sensor 1

Generic OBD-II · all makesPowertrain (engine & transmission)

Code P0546 indicates the powertrain control module (PCM) has detected a high voltage condition in the exhaust gas temperature (EGT) sensor circuit for bank 1, sensor 1. This sensor measures exhaust temperature before the catalytic converter or turbocharger, and a high circuit reading often points to an open circuit, short to voltage, or a failed sensor. The code sets when the signal voltage exceeds a calibrated threshold for a specified time.

What causes it — most likely first

1. Faulty exhaust gas temperature sensor (Bank 1, Sensor 1)

The sensor itself may have an internal open circuit or short to voltage, causing a high signal return to the PCM. This is the most common cause.

2. Open or shorted wiring in the EGT sensor circuit

Damaged, corroded, or broken wiring between the sensor and PCM can create an open circuit (infinite resistance) or a short to a reference voltage, leading to a high voltage reading.

3. Poor electrical connection at the sensor

Loose, corroded, or pushed-out terminals in the sensor connector can cause high resistance or intermittent open circuits, triggering the code.

5. PCM failure (rare)

Internal PCM faults are an uncommon cause. The PCM should only be considered after all other possibilities are thoroughly ruled out.

How it's diagnosed

  1. Visually inspect the EGT sensor, wiring, and connector for obvious damage, corrosion, or loose connections.
  2. Check the sensor's resistance with a multimeter (key off, sensor disconnected) and compare to manufacturer specifications at known temperatures.
  3. Test the sensor signal circuit for a short to voltage by measuring voltage at the connector with the key on, engine off.
  4. Verify the sensor's ground and reference voltage circuits (if applicable) are within specification.
  5. Use a scan tool to monitor EGT sensor voltage while manipulating the wiring harness to check for intermittent opens or shorts.
  6. If all other tests pass, follow the manufacturer's pinpoint tests to rule out a PCM fault before replacing the module.

Frequently asked

Can I drive with a P0546 code?

It may be possible to drive short distances, but the vehicle could enter a reduced power mode or experience poor fuel economy. Prolonged driving with a faulty EGT sensor may lead to catalytic converter or turbocharger damage.

What does the exhaust gas temperature sensor do?

It monitors exhaust temperature to protect components like the turbocharger and catalytic converter from overheating, and helps the PCM optimize fuel delivery and emissions control.

Is it safe to replace just the sensor, or do I need to replace the PCM?

In almost all cases, replacing the sensor or repairing the wiring fixes this code. PCM failure is extremely rare for this circuit-high code, and a PCM should never be replaced without exhaustive testing of the sensor, wiring, and connectors first.

Why do some shops recommend replacing the PCM for this code?

Misdiagnosis can occur if the sensor circuit is not properly tested. A high voltage code is often misinterpreted as a PCM internal fault, but the overwhelming majority of fixes involve the sensor or wiring. Always insist on a step-by-step diagnosis before replacing the PCM.
